Conklin, NY is a small town located in upstate New York. It is home to a variety of companies and attractions, offering something for everyone. Some of the local companies include Conklin Nurseries, Crumb Bakery, and Hibernia Distillery. There are also several attractions such as the Conklin Historical Society Museum, Broome County Nature Preserve, and Lazy River Trail. In addition to these businesses and attractions, the town also offers affordable housing with average 2 bedroom rent being $1,260 compared to a US average of $1,430. What's more, groceries are also cheaper in Conklin than the US average according to a Grocery Cost Index score of 98 versus 100 in the US.

Conklin has an unemployment rate of 7.0%. The US average is 6.0%.

Conklin has seen the job market decrease by -0.3% over the last year. Future job growth over the next ten years is predicted to be 19.1%, which is lower than the US average of 33.5%.

Tax Rates for Conklin
- The Sales Tax Rate for Conklin is 8.0%. The US average is 7.3%.
- The Income Tax Rate for Conklin is 6.5%. The US average is 4.6%.
- Tax Rates can have a big impact when Comparing Cost of Living.

Income and Salaries for Conklin
- The average income of a Conklin resident is $25,915 a year. The US average is $28,555 a year.
- The Median household income of a Conklin resident is $60,427 a year. The US average is $69,021 a year.
